5 votes

Impossible d'installer fastcgi sur un serveur ubuntu : Le paquet libapache2-mod-fastcgi n'est pas disponible.

Lorsque j'essaie d'installer fastcgi dans le serveur ubuntu 12.04, j'obtiens l'erreur suivante :

sudo apt-get install libapache2-mod-fastcgi

Reading package lists... Done
Building dependency tree       
Reading state information... Done
Package libapache2-mod-fastcgi is not available, but is referred to by another package.
This may mean that the package is missing, has been obsoleted, or
is only available from another source

E: Package 'libapache2-mod-fastcgi' has no installation candidate

Une solution ?

14voto

hasnat Points 101

libapache2-mod-fastcgi peuvent être trouvés dans multivers . Si je me souviens bien, une installation par défaut d'Ubuntu ne permettait pas d'activer multivers (mais devraient l'être de nos jours).

Il se peut qu'il soit désactivé sur votre système et que vous deviez l'ajouter à la liste des dépôts (aussi simple que d'éditer /etc/apt/sources.list et en ajoutant multivers après principal ou en utilisant le gestionnaire de paquets graphique).

Vaisseaux Debian libapache2-mod-fastcgi dans le cadre de non libre d'ailleurs, donc c'est probablement un problème de licence.

0voto

Khaled Points 35208

Ce paquet peut être trouvé dans les paquets d'ubuntu 12.04 en tant que montré ici . Vous avez peut-être des sources d'apt non valides. Avez-vous apporté des modifications à vos sources ?

Vous pouvez aussi essayer de courir :

$ sudo apt-get update
$ sudo apt-get upgrade

pour mettre à jour votre liste de paquets et mettre à niveau les paquets qui doivent l'être.

0voto

mschr Points 48

Si vous ne pouvez pas exécuter une mise à jour/mise à niveau correcte, essayez d'émettre ce qui suit

sudo apt-get check

et s'il y a des 'dépendances cassées', exécutez ce que khaled a dit avec -f ajouté, comme suit :

sudo apt-get -f update
sudo apt-get -f upgrade

0voto

Anil Jahangir Points 1

Vous pouvez télécharger le fichier .deb à partir de https://packages.ubuntu.com/xenial/libapache2-mod-fastcgi et l'installer avec sudo dpkg -i nomfichier.deb Cette solution fonctionne pour moi.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X